118.227 Method for filling vacancy in slate of candidate before primary
election.

If a vacancy occurs in a slate of candidates before the ballots are printed for
the primary election because of death, disqualification to hold the office sought,
or severe disabling condition which arose after the deadline for filing the
notification and declaration, the remaining member of the slate may:
(a) Designate a replacement for the vacant candidate; or
(b) Change the composition of the slate and designate a running mate.
Any changes made to the slate of candidates as set forth in this subsection
shall be made on forms prescribed by the State Board of Elections and filed
with the Secretary of State not later than the deadline for printing primary
election ballots, but only following certification to the remaining candidates by
the Secretary of State that a vacancy exists for a reason specified in this
subsection. The Secretary of State shall immediately certify any changes made
to a slate of candidates to the appropriate county clerk, the Registry of Election
Finance, and the State Board of Elections.
If a vacancy occurs in a slate of candidates after the ballots are printed for the
primary, the remaining member of the slate may:
(a) Designate a replacement for the vacant candidate; or
(b) Change the composition of the slate and designate a running mate.
Any changes made to the slate of candidates as set forth in this subsection
shall be made on forms prescribed by the State Board of Elections and filed
with the Secretary of State filed with the registry prior to the primary election,
but only following certification to the remaining candidate by the Secretary of
State that a vacancy exists for a reason specified in subsection (1) of this
section. The Secretary of State shall immediately certify any changes made to
a slate of candidates to the appropriate county clerk, the Registry of Election
Finance, and the State Board of Elections.
If a replacement for a vacant candidate is made after the ballots are printed for
the primary because of death, disqualification to hold the office sought, or
severe disabling condition which arose after the deadline for filing the
notification and declaration, notices informing the voters of the change in the
composition of the slate shall be printed by the State Board of Elections and
sent to the appropriate county clerk to be posted at each precinct polling place.
Any votes cast prior to any changes made to the composition of a slate shall be
counted as votes cast for the new slate composition.
The provisions of KRS 118.105 shall apply to vacancies occurring in the
nomination of a qualifying slate of candidates.
Effective:July 15, 2008
History: Amended 2008 Ky. Acts ch. 79, sec. 12, effective July 15, 2008. -Created 2005 Ky. Acts ch. 105, sec. 16, effective March 16, 2005.
